Output e95c1ec7366f60d48d3f820822364ddb850386dbfc2bbd93e4e07472b6ea618e:0

value
25682406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 628c619c1f2e09766bc706266a703b300a2d9f53 OP_EQUAL
address
MGtEd6KPT2Em1zxGEc75KGPaBbaT51dXv1
transaction
e95c1ec7366f60d48d3f820822364ddb850386dbfc2bbd93e4e07472b6ea618e
spent
true